What companies run services between Camp de Tarragona (Station), Spain and Lisbon, Portugal?

You can take a train from Camp De Tarragona to Lisboa Oriente via Madrid-Puerta de Atocha-Almudena Grandes, Badajoz, and Entroncamento in around 14h 7m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Camp de Tarragona to Lisbon - Oriente via Reus and Estación Central de Autobuses de Zaragoza in around 16h 10m.
